Form 4: Bank of America Corp Reports Transaction in Invesco Quality Municipal Income Trust
SEC Form 4 Filing
Bank of America Corporation, along with Merrill Lynch, Pierce, Fenner & Smith Incorporated, reports transactions involving Invesco Quality Municipal Income Trust shares, indicating a change in beneficial ownership.
Summary
- Bank of America Corporation, along with Merrill Lynch, Pierce, Fenner & Smith Incorporated, filed a Form 4 with the SEC on December 20, 2024.
- The filing reports transactions in Invesco Quality Municipal Income Trust [IQI] common stock that occurred on April 24, 2012.
- The transactions involved the purchase and sale of shares at prices of $13.94 and $13.95.
- After these transactions, Bank of America Corporation, through its subsidiary Merrill Lynch, holds no shares.
- The reporting persons disclaim beneficial ownership of the securities except to the extent of their pecuniary interest.
- A Joint Filing Agreement is included as an exhibit.

Industry Context
Form 4 filings are standard disclosures required by the SEC to provide transparency into the transactions of company insiders and major shareholders, allowing the public to monitor potential changes in ownership and sentiment.
